Improved total variation method for image inpainting

Abstract: An improved image inpainting method based on the total variation algorithm is presented in this paper.The relativity coefficient is introduced according to the surrounding information of the damaged area.With the help of the relativity coefficient,we gradually diffuse the surrounding information to the damaged area and restore the damaged area.A range of experiments show that the new method is effective for the image inpainting,and the edge of the damaged area becomes more natural.

Key words: image processing, image inpainting, total variation, relativity coefficient
